On Thu 21 January 2016 09:41:46 Tony Lindgren wrote: > Then for supporting the USB host mode.. We should add regulator support > to the USB PHY driver so if the ID pin is grounded, the PHY driver enables > the VBUS regulator. That too seems to need some coordination between the > drivers/phy/phy-twl4030-usb.c and 1707 driver if the ID pin interrupt is > only detected in drivers/phy/phy-twl4030-usb.c. Note that, while this is probably a good thing to do, it needs to be sufficiently loose coupling to allow user to 'intercept' this VBOOS regulator enabling and instead allow device charging while in externally powered hostmode. There's even a spec for this in USB-docs-foo iirc, something along a certain resistor value on ID to GND - alas I guess the twl4030 is not capable to detect such sophisticated signaling, and anyway it's always desirable to allow user to manually override the VBOOST and enable VBUS-charging while in hostmode. On N900 the situation is even more complex since the 1707 doesn't support genuine ID detection, neither does it support emulated ID grounding. And there's no other method than a ID=GND message from PHY to musb core to make the musb core state engine transfer into proper hostmode. Thus my H-E-N hostmode botch abuses debug flags to force the musb core into a "emulated" hostmode and this mode doesn't support USB speed detection. Thus speed settings are forced onto musb core and PHY by software, and the musb core speed bits are only effective before session enabled. Bottom line: you need VBUS to try and negotiate speed with the attached device in hostmode, but to actually set this speed you detected by software means, you need to disable and discharge VBUS again, or musb core won't care about the speed you set. To be utterly clear: unconditional enabling of VBUS in ID=GND won't work. On Thu 21 January 2016 11:21:13 Tony Lindgren wrote: > Do you have some pointer > to the "certain resistor value on ID to GND" spec? Is it maybe part of > the carkit related parts of the USB spec? ""Three additional ID pin states are defined[4] at the nominal resistance values of 124 kΩ, 68 kΩ, and 36.5 kΩ, with respect to the ground pin. These permit the device to work with USB Accessory Charger Adapters that allows the OTG device to be attached to both a charger and another device simultaneously.
